Simplexity Appoints Rook CMO

Reston, Va. –
Simplexity, a leading authorized mobile e-tailer and master agent, has named
Dave Rook executive VP and chief marketing officer (CMO).

 Rook, who has held brand management and
marketing strategy positions at AOL, Coca-Cola and the Leo Burnett advertising
agency, will be responsible for the strategic direction and implementation of Simplexity’s
marketing initiatives, including advertising, media, marketing analysis,
partner and product marketing, promotions, customer relationship management and
user experience.

He will also
oversee all aspects of brand marketing and management for Wirefly.com, the
company’s online cellphone store.

Simplexity also sells
wireless products and services though thousands of private-branded websites and
affiliate programs that it operates for companies including Kmart, Newegg, RadioShack,
Sears, Sony, Target and TigerDirect. Its proprietary e-commerce platform provides
online merchandising, rate-plan management, procurement, customer care and
customer relationship marketing, billing, order processing, automated cellphone
activations and fulfillment for the largest carriers in the U.S.
